Paradise Reef - North Carolina

North Carolina's Paradise Reef is an interesting spot for East Coast divers. The reef itself is a natural coral formation, not a wreck, which sets it apart from many local dives. While we haven't seen any specific species data, local reports suggest a decent variety of smaller reef fish and invertebrates. It’s a good option for divers looking for a natural reef experience in the region, perhaps as a second dive.
